Ping
Website Ping Test Online Tool
In today's digital world website performance is very important to make users happy and helps their businesses to succeed. A website ping test is a tool that is used for checking and improving how well a website performs.
Wherever you run a personal blog or an e-commerce site, understanding how a website ping works can help you keep your site fast, reliable, and always available for users.
What is a Website Ping Test?
A website ping test measures how quickly your computer communicates with the server hosting of a website.
A ping test sends a small packet of data from your computer to the server, then it measures how long it takes for the server to send it back. This tool helps you see the dealy, or latency in your connection to the server.
How Does It Work?
A website ping test sends a small request from your device to the server hosting the website. The server processes the request and sends a response back to your device.
The time it takes for this round trip communication is called ping time or latency. It is measured in milliseconds (ms), lower ping times mean faster communication between your device and the server.
Key Metrics in a Ping Test:
- Ping Time (Latency): The time it takes for a data packet to travel from the client to the server and back.
- Packet Loss: The percentage of packets that were sent but never received by the server or returned to the client.
- Time-to-Live (TTL): It measures how long a data packet can travel before it’s discarded, helping to prevent data from looping in a network.
- Jitter: The variation in ping time. Consistent ping times indicate a stable connection, while fluctuating times (high jitter) suggest instability.
How to use this tool
Here’s how you can use this tool by following these steps:
- Select the Ping Protocol (HTTPs, Ping, Host/Port).
- If you select HTTP(s) simply paste the website url and click on submit button, or if you select ping then enter the host url, or if you select Host/Port option then enter the host url and port and then click on the submit button.
Importance of Website Ping Test
A ping test is a basic tool for spotting potential problems with website performance and network connections. Here's why it’s important:
1. Identifying Latency Issues
Latency, or delay, can greatly affect user experience. A slow website can frustrate users, causing them to leave before the page loads. A ping test tool can help you to spot high latency, allowing you to improve the server performance or network routing.
2. Monitoring Server Uptime
Website ping tests are commonly used to see if a server is online and responding. If a ping test fails, it could mean the server is down or having problems, it can harm your website’s credibility, affect your SEO ranking, and reduce user trust.
3. Troubleshooting Network Problems
Network blockage, faulty routing, or other issues with the Internet Service Provider (ISP) can slow down a website. Running a ping test helps determine if the problem is with the server or somewhere along the network path between your device and the server.
4. Ensuring Optimal Performance for Global Users
If your website has a global audience, you can run ping tests from different locations to see if users in various areas are facing delays. This can help you set up a Content Delivery Network (CDN) to speed up load times by storing content closer to users.
5. Evaluating Hosting and Server Providers
Regular ping tests let you assess the quality of your website's hosting provider. Consistently high ping times may indicate that you need to upgrade your server or switch to a more reliable hosting service.
How to Conduct a Website Ping Test
There are various methods to perform a website ping test, each suited to different needs and technical expertise levels. Below are some common ways:
1. Command Line (Ping Command)
The most basic way to run a ping test is through the command line on Windows, macOS, or Linux. Here’s how to do it:
On Windows:
- Open Command Prompt.
- Type the command: ping www.gizelia.com. Type the domain url which you want to test.
- Press Enter. The results will show the ping times and any packet loss.
On macOS/Linux:
- Open Terminal.
- Type the command: ping www.example.com.
- Press Enter. The same ping data will be displayed as on Windows.
3. Network Monitoring Software
For more in-depth monitoring, network administrators often use software such as:
- SolarWinds Network Performance Monitor: A robust tool that provides detailed network diagnostics, including ping tests.
- Nagios: An open-source monitoring tool that tracks network health and server performance.
- PRTG Network Monitor: Provides real-time network insights, including ping times and packet loss.
Interpreting Ping Test Results
Once you’ve run a ping test, understanding the results is crucial. Here’s how to interpret the key metrics:
1. Ping Time
- 0-50 ms: Excellent. Users will experience virtually no delay.
- 51-100 ms: Good. Most users won’t notice any significant lag.
- 101-200 ms: Average. You may experience some delay, particularly for real-time applications like gaming or video conferencing.
- 201+ ms: Poor. Users will experience noticeable delays, which could hurt website usability.
2. Packet Loss
Packet loss occurs when some of the data packets sent during the ping test do not return. Even a small percentage of packet loss (above 1-2%) can indicate issues with the network or server.
3. Jitter
Jitter refers to inconsistencies in the ping time. Low jitter indicates a stable connection, while high jitter suggests variability in response times, which can degrade user experience, especially in real-time applications like voice calls.
How Ping Tests Affect Website Performance
While a website ping test is a useful tool, remember that ping times aren’t the only factor affecting website performance. Website speed, server load, and content optimization also play important roles in how quickly a website responds to user requests.
Here are some factors that can influence ping test results and website performance:.
1. Server Location
The physical distance between the server and the user directly affects ping times. Websites hosted on servers closer to the user usually have faster ping times.
2. Server Load
A heavily loaded server may take longer to process ping requests, leading to higher ping times. Making sure your server has enough resources to handle traffic spikes can help keep response times low.
3. Network Routing
The route that data takes from the user’s device to the server can affect ping times. Sometimes, the data packet may travel through multiple network points, which can increase latency.
4. Content Delivery Network (CDN)
CDNs store copies of your website’s content on multiple servers worldwide, reducing the distance between the server and the user. This can greatly improve ping times and overall website speed.
Best Practices to Improve Website Ping Times
If you consistently see high ping times during your website ping test, you can use several strategies to improve performance:
1. Optimize Server Resources
Make sure your hosting plan has enough resources (CPU, RAM, bandwidth) to handle your website traffic. Upgrade to a more powerful server if needed.
2. Use a CDN
Using a Content Delivery Network (CDN) can help spread your website content across different locations, reducing the distance between your users and the server.
3. Choose a Reliable Hosting Provider
Choose a hosting provider that is known for speed and uptime. Many providers offer plans specifically designed for low latency and fast response times.
4. Monitor Regularly
Regular ping tests can help you monitor website performance. Set up automatic tests to get alerts if the server becomes unresponsive or if ping times go beyond acceptable limits.
5. Reduce Server Load
Optimize your website to lessen server load. Reduce the use of large images, enable compression, and use caching techniques to make your site lighter and more responsive.
Conclusion
A website ping test is an essential tool for monitoring and improving website performance. By measuring latency, packet loss, and jitter, a ping test provides valuable insights into your site's responsiveness.
Whether you manage a personal blog or a large corporate website, regularly running ping tests can help you spot issues early, ensure server uptime, and deliver a smooth user experience.
Frequently Asked Questions
What is a website ping test?
A website ping test checks the speed of communication between your device and a server, helping you understand how quickly a website responds.
How do I perform a ping test?
You can perform a ping test using the command prompt on your computer or by using online ping test tools to check server response times.
Why is low ping important?
Low ping is important because it means faster communication between your device and the server, leading to a better user experience and quicker website loading times.
How often should I run ping tests?
You should run ping tests regularly, especially during traffic spikes or after making changes to your website, to monitor performance and spot potential issues early.
What causes high ping times?
High ping times can be caused by server load, long physical distances, network congestion, or issues with your Internet Service Provider (ISP).